Output 8058914d8407155e2a3a2520c33bccff6f1753e339a775c78e6dc7442600007c:1

value
19983
script pubkey
OP_0 OP_PUSHBYTES_20 e91fcf8210abeffb1341cb33b3bcbc4f318ad8a0
address
bc1qay0ulqss40hlky6pevem809ufucc4k9q445edn
transaction
8058914d8407155e2a3a2520c33bccff6f1753e339a775c78e6dc7442600007c
confirmations
136454
spent
true